#469314 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#469314 is composed of 27.5% red, 57.6%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.4%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 96.4 degrees, a saturation of 76% and a lightness of 32.7%. #469314 color hex could be obtained by blending #8cff28 with #002700.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#469314 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#469314 has RGB values of R:70, G:147,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.86,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 4625172.

Shades and Tints of #469314
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040901 is the darkest color, while #f9fef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#469314
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#52594e is the less saturated color, while #42a601 is the most saturated one.
